Courteney Cox Makes Her 'Web Therapy' Debut Sept. 6 on Showtime
By April MacIntyre Sep 1, 2011, 4:24 GMT

06/20/2011 - Courteney Cox - 2011 Critics\' Choice Television Awards - Arrivals - Beverly Hills Hotel - Beverly Hills, CA, USA © Andrew Evans / PR Photos
Tune in alert for Showtime, as "Friends" former costars Courteney Cox and Lisa Kudrow star together on the latest episode of "Web Therapy."
“Fiona Wallice” (Lisa Kudrow), television’s worst online therapist, will add a new client to her roster as Courteney Cox (“Cougar Town”) guest stars on the Showtime comedy series Web Therapy on Tuesday, September 6th at 11:00 PM ET/PT.

Cox plays “Serena Duvall,” an internet psychic who turns to therapy to regain her powers. Not a fan of psychics, Fiona is skeptical as Serena explains that her dreams are a critical tool in conjuring up accurate visions about her clients but lately, they seem to be meaningless.
Will Fiona succeed in getting Serena’s “gift” back or will the two former “Friends” end up frenemies?
